摘要
Whether laser surface strengthening on module steel can have an effect on intensity, shock resistance and wearing resistance. Through analysis of different materials with different laser methods, this paper uses high-power carbon dioxide lasers to process the work of strengthening laser on CrWMn, conduct structural analysis and test on laser hardening layer, through data and figure, demonstrate that primary structure of the matrix is obviously detailed after processing and the intensity is obviously strengthened. After laser surface melting on H13, we find that the surface flawless, smooth, even and fine, highly intense and non-corrosive.
